https://www.espn.com/college-football/s ... p-contract
Under proposed 14-team format, which this says is closer to being set in stone.
"(There will no longer be a participation bonus for any of the other leagues -- a detail that was frustrating to some leaders in the Group of 5.)
The Group of Five schools revenue will increase to just under $1.8 million from the current $1.5 million. According to multiple sources, American Athletic Conference commissioner Mike Aresco has been the most outspoken critic of the plan, but hasn't been able to garner enough support from other commissioners to fight it."
